Support for High Priority Contracts

The CARE Team is a specialist operational team working across London and the South East, established to strengthen performance on our most critical and high-risk contracts, supporting our clients’ and residents’ needs.

The team is deployed where it delivers the greatest value, supporting peak demand, new contract mobilisations, and complex operational challenges that require experienced, high-impact intervention.

Engineers and operatives assigned to the CARE Team benefit from an enhanced pay and benefits package, reflecting the increased responsibility, flexibility, and performance expectations associated with this work.

This includes higher earning potential and access to additional benefits designed to recognise skills, commitment, and adaptability.

Trusted to stabilise services, reinforce control, and raise delivery standards, the CARE Team operates at pace in fast-moving, demanding environments.

Team members work across multiple contracts, engage with a wide range of clients, and rapidly adapt to different systems, processes, and operational models.

Each deployment presents a new challenge and a clear objective: to deliver visible, measurable improvements in service delivery, customer confidence, and operational performance.

Overall Purpose

Carry out a range of multi-trade repairs and maintenance works in occupied and void properties, delivering a high standard of workmanship and customer service.

Work across responsive repairs, planned maintenance and remedial tasks as required, ensuring jobs are completed safely, efficiently and to specification.

Support the smooth delivery of services in social housing and property maintenance environments, maintaining accurate records and communicating effectively with residents, colleagues and clients.

  • Key Tasks / Activities / Responsibilities
  • Complete multi-trade repairs including carpentry, plumbing, patch plastering, tiling, decorating and basic flooring works.
  • Diagnose faults, identify materials required and complete works right first time wherever possible.
  • Carry out responsive repairs and void property works within agreed timescales and quality standards.
  • Ensure all work is undertaken safely, following risk assessments, method statements and site procedures.
  • Use handheld devices or job management systems to record progress, materials used and completion notes.
  • Liaise professionally with residents, reporting any access issues, additional works or safeguarding concerns.
  • Maintain tools, equipment and van stock in good order and request materials as needed.
  • Escalate complex defects, specialist works or follow-on requirements to the appropriate supervisor.
  • Work collaboratively with other trades and support service delivery across the contract.
  • Undertake any other duties reasonably required within the scope of the role.
